Abstract
The present invention discloses a polarizing filter and a display device. The polarizing filter comprises a polarization layer and a conductive layer provided on one side of the polarization layer. In the present invention, the conductive layer is provided on the polarization layer, thus, when the electrostatic charge are present on the color film substrate having the polarizing filter, the electrostatic charge may be shielded by the conductive layer, and will not adversely affect the liquid crystal molecule between the color film substrate and a array substrate celled to the color film substrate even if the charge are present on a surface of the color film substrate, such that the display quality of the display panel having the color film substrate and the array substrate is improved. In addition, there is no need to provide a conductive tape used to guide the electrostatic charge out of the color film substrate in the display panel, so as to prevent some undesirable phenomenon, such as local uneven force on the panel, light leak and glue residue and the like, caused by the arrangement of the conductive tape.
